After a couple of weeks wear, I had a trip that required me to use a rucksack, which, given it’s an outdoor garment I thought nothing of. After the trip I noticed that the back looked like it had melted a bit. Hmmm. I thought it would ‘heal’ itself as I wore it over the next few outings. It didn’t, and the making was bad enough for Dr B to comment on it. I birthday was 10th March btw.
So I sent an email to Paramo asking for their advise/take on it. I sent the email on Saturday, and someone from customer services replied at 8:20 on the Monday morning asking me if I would return the smock because it should not wear like that. After a couple or theee back and forths with email, I had a returns label and on Thursday I sent it back to them. It arrived with them late yesterday afternoon.
This morning I’ve received a further email from them saying that they recommend that I’d be better off with the standard weight rather than the light weight smock if I’m going to regularly use a rucksack, but that would be £20 more. Or they’ll just send me a replacement. I’d like to get arsey with them about asking for another £20 but a) that would be just arsey of me, and b) at no point have they said it’s my fault for misusing the garment and are actually offering me a better solution with no actual loss to me. All in all, it’s pretty good customer service in my book. Well it would be if…
